Nong Khai Immigration tightens screening measures

NONG KHAI, 4 September 2015 (NNT) - Immigration officials in Nong Khai province have exerted greater vigilance at the border checkpoint, as police continue to search for those behind the Ratchaprasong bombing.


Nong Khai Immigration Chief Police Colonel Panlop Suriyakul Na Ayutthaya has instructed police officers to be more rigorous in screening and monitoring foreign nationals that enter and leave Thailand. He singled out the the border checkpoint, the Thai-Lao Friendship Bridge and the train station.

Police will also conduct a sweep of Nong Khai hotels. Hoteliers will be fined if any foreign nationals are found to have stayed at their accommodations without reporting to Immigration.

There are currently 41 Chinese nationals conducting business at Indo-China market and two Turkish men living in Nong Khai.
